Lil B Gets Invited To Try Out For An NBA D-League Team

Source: Roger Kisby / Getty
Lil B is a jack of all trades. Besides being a rapper, he’s a public speaker, and an avid basketball fan. When he’s not placing curses on some of your favorite athletes like Kevin Durant and James Harden, he’s on the court trying to turn his hoop dreams into reality. Now, it appears the Lil B will have a second chance at redemption as he’ll try out for the D-League with the Delaware 87ers.
If you recall, Lil B tried out for the Santa Cruz Warriors last season. Obviously, he didn’t make the team. But, at least he was out here getting buckets.
